ZLDO1117G50TA belongs to the category of voltage regulators.
This product is primarily used for regulating voltage in electronic circuits.
ZLDO1117G50TA comes in a small surface-mount package.
The essence of ZLDO1117G50TA lies in its ability to provide stable and regulated voltage output for various electronic applications.
This product is typically packaged in reels or tubes, with a quantity of 2500 units per reel/tube.

ZLDO1117G50TA operates based on the principle of linear voltage regulation. It uses a pass transistor to regulate the output voltage by adjusting the resistance between the input and output terminals. This ensures that the output voltage remains constant, even when the input voltage varies.
ZLDO1117G50TA finds applications in various electronic devices and systems, including: - Power supplies - Battery-powered devices - Embedded systems - Consumer electronics - Industrial control systems

Q: What is ZLDO1117G50TA? A: ZLDO1117G50TA is a low dropout linear voltage regulator IC that provides a fixed output voltage of 5V.
Q: What is the input voltage range for ZLDO1117G50TA? A: The input voltage range for ZLDO1117G50TA is typically between 6V and 15V.
Q: What is the maximum output current of ZLDO1117G50TA? A: The maximum output current of ZLDO1117G50TA is 1A.
Q: Can ZLDO1117G50TA be used in battery-powered applications? A: Yes, ZLDO1117G50TA can be used in battery-powered applications as long as the input voltage is within the specified range.
Q: Does ZLDO1117G50TA require any external components for operation? A: Yes, ZLDO1117G50TA requires input and output capacitors for stability and proper operation.
Q: What is the dropout voltage of ZLDO1117G50TA? A: The dropout voltage of ZLDO1117G50TA is typically around 1.2V at full load.
Q: Can ZLDO1117G50TA handle short-circuit conditions? A: Yes, ZLDO1117G50TA has built-in short-circuit protection to prevent damage under such conditions.
Q: Is ZLDO1117G50TA suitable for noise-sensitive applications? A: Yes, ZLDO1117G50TA has good noise rejection capabilities, making it suitable for noise-sensitive applications.
Q: Can ZLDO1117G50TA be used in automotive applications? A: Yes, ZLDO1117G50TA is designed to meet the requirements of automotive applications.
Q: What is the thermal resistance of ZLDO1117G50TA? A: The thermal resistance of ZLDO1117G50TA is typically around 50°C/W, which determines its ability to dissipate heat.
